Calculate the length b to two decimal places

In figure given two sides and the included angle (SAS) so we can apply cosine rule.
[tex]b^{2}=a^{2}+c^{2}-2accosB.[/tex]
In the figure a=22,c=14,<B=110°
Substituting these values in cosine formula :
[tex]b^{2}=22^{2}+14^{2}-2(22)(14)cos 110 .[/tex]
[tex]b^{2}=484+196-616(-0.34)[/tex]
[tex]b^{2}=680+209.44[/tex]
[tex]b^{2}=889.44[/tex]
b=29.84.
